Semantic Web inquiry system and method is based on the present invention relates to (DBMS)-of a kind of data base management system to inquire using parametrization SPARQL. The present invention is configured to include output means, generates a parameter list from SPARQL query statements, is ...
In the following, we explain how to use these query builder methods. For simplicity, we assume the underlying database is MySQL. Note that if you are using other DBMS, the table/column/value quoting shown in the examples may be different....
If not set, it means selecting all columns. 参见select(). public array $select = null $selectOption 公共 属性 Additional option that should be appended to the 'SELECT' keyword. For example, in MySQL, the option 'SQL_CALC_FOUND_ROWS' can be used. public string $selectOption = null $...
Flexible queries play important roles in intelligent information retrieval and have become the main means to realize data querying. Bosc and Pivert [25] point out that a query is flexible if it satisfies one of the following conditions. • A qualitative distinction between the selected entities ...
Furthermore, theCDbConnection::createCommand()method can take an array as the parameter. The name-value pairs in the array will be used to initialize the properties of the createdCDbCommandinstance. This means, we can use the following code to build a query: ...
本节主要描述,如何评估不同DBMS中,Cardinality对优化器的影响,也就是DBMS间Cardinality预估值的准确性。 作者对5个关系数据库加载了IMDB数据集,分别是PostgreSQL、HyPer和3个商业数据库, 使用default settings执行每个数据库系统的统计信息收集命令,以生成estimation算法所使用的特定于数据库的统计信息(例如,直方图或样本)...
In most cases, this SQL statement is sent to the DBMS right away, where it is compiled. As a result, thePreparedStatementobject contains not just a SQL statement, but a SQL statement that has been precompiled. This means that when thePreparedStatementis executed, the DBMS can just run thePr...
Modern database management systems (DBMS), primarily designed as general-purpose systems, face the challenging task of efficiently handling data from diverse sources for both analytical services and online transactional processing (OLTP). The volume of d
province isCA. Assume that the bitmap101000...corresponds to the customer ID key value103515from thecustomerstable subquery. Also assume that thecustomerssubquery produces the key value103516with the bitmap010000..., which means that only row 2 insaleshas a matching key value from the subquery...
In SQL, the OFFSET clause is used to skip a specific number of rows before starting to return records from a query. That means specifying a starting point for row selection, which is useful for excluding a given number of records. In databases that support the non-standard LIMIT clause, th...